Base Safety Coordinator

Sheltair is committed to excellence in the construction and aviation industry, focusing on quality design and customer service. The Base Safety Coordinator is responsible for training line staff on safety and operational procedures, monitoring employee progress, and ensuring compliance with company regulations.

Responsibilities

Provide initial and recurrent hands-on training for line staff, including an emphasis on safety, service, efficiency and performance
Training to be facilitated in the classroom and on the job
Monitor and document new hires’ progression in the various stages of learning and report progress monthly to GM
Ensure full compliance with all rules, regulations, policies and procedures of the company and industry
Qualify trainees’ when performing driving tasks with tugs, fuel trucks, golf carts, and crew vehicles if applicable
Perform administrative tasks, clerical tasks and projects as needed
Will be required to meet with the Director of Safety and other members of the management team to monitor employee progress and address performance strengths/weaknesses
Work hand-in-hand with Line Manager to mentor and ensure employees’ realize their full potential and have opportunities for continued growth
Facilitate and arrange safety meetings, briefings, fire drills and hurricane plan
Recommend new policies as necessary for base specific safety and operational procedures
Fill in for line staff, QC and line supervisor as operation requires
